Yamaha DXR15mkIII is an active liveportable that cost around 1700 USD for a pair.

  • Quality of the measurement data is medium.
  • Origin of the data is Yamaha.
  • Format of the data is a GLL file .
  • -3dB (resp. -6db) point v.s. reference is at 54.5Hz (resp. 51.5Hz).
  • Reference level is normalised to -0.1dB computed over the frequency range [300.0Hz, 5000.0Hz].
  • Frequency deviation is 1.3dB over the same frequency range.
  • Tonality (Preference) Score is *** (measurement is truncated at low frequencies).
  • Tonality (Preference) Score with EQ is *** (measurement is truncated at low frequencies).

Vendor specifications

  • Dispersion: 90° horizontal and 60° vertical.
  • SPL
    • peak: 134 dB
  • Size
    • Width 447mm
    • Height 699mm
    • Depth 380mm
  • Weight 21.0kg
